INTONATION COMPONENTS OF THE KAZAKH LANGUAGE
Abstract
The article discusses the intonational components of the Kazakh language. The role of separate components such as melodics, tempo, intensity, voice-frequency range, interval has been revealed. Their acoustic characteristics by means of the computer program have been described.
